The movie is indeed "Bullitt" with Steve McQueen in the title role.

The chase you refer to is considered by most movie buffs to be the best in
movie history (I could make an argument for the original "Gone In 60
Seconds").

One of the magazines recently did an article on the "Bullitt" Mustangs used
in the movie. One is still alive and stored in a barn where people are
literally chased off with at gunpoint when inquiring about the car...reminds
you of the also recent story of the original Cobra Coupe...
